美文网首页
jar 包配置文件读取小工具

jar 包配置文件读取小工具

作者: 大猪大猪 | 来源:发表于2019-10-31 17:55 被阅读0次

    实现

    final class ConfigUtil
    object ConfigUtil {
    
      def properties(): Properties = props()
    
      private def props(): Properties = {
        val properties = new Properties()
        val env = sys.props.getOrElse("env", "dev")
        properties.load(classOf[ConfigUtil].getResourceAsStream("/" + env + ".properties"))
        properties
      }
    
    }
    

    多环境区分

    resources/dev.properties
    resources/pro.properties
    

    运行使用

    java -jar demo.jar -Denv=pro
    

    相关文章

      网友评论

          本文标题:jar 包配置文件读取小工具

          本文链接:https://www.haomeiwen.com/subject/mawtbctx.html